Variant summary
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M1BS2
The NM_021120.4(DLG3):āc.5A>Cā(p.His2Pro)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000959 in 1,043,050 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 4 hemizygotes in GnomAD. Variant has been reported in ClinVar as Uncertain significance (ā ā ).

DLG3 (HGNC:2902): (discs large MAGUK scaffold protein 3) This gene encodes a member of the membrane-associated guanylate kinase protein family. The encoded protein may play a role in clustering of NMDA receptors at excitatory synapses. It may also negatively regulate cell proliferation through interaction with the C-terminal region of the adenomatosis polyposis coli tumor suppressor protein. Mutations in this gene have been associated with X-linked cognitive disability. Alternatively spliced transcript variants have been described. [provided by RefSeq, Oct 2009]
